Channel Migration and Avulsion Hazards at Sunshine Point Campground, Mount Rainier National Park, Washington
(2015-03)
In November 2006, the flood of record on the upper Nisqually River destroyed part of Sunshine Point Campground in Mount Rainier National Park, Washington.
